General Information
The Traverse City Swim club is an age group swim club operating under the policies of Michigan Swimming, a division of USA Swimming (USS). It is composed of boys and girls, ages 5 to 18, who live in the Grand Traverse area. The team exists to provide an opportunity for young people to participate in competitive swimming. TCSC is a parent-run organization and as such requires parent participation to be successful. Coach Toby Tisdale brings years of coaching experience to the summer 2008 program
When Does the Summer 2008 Program Begin?
The summer 2008 program begins on Monday, July 7th and runs through Friday, August 1st. Dryland practice is held from 8 to 9 a.m. on Mondays, Tuesdays, Wednesdays and Fridays. Swim practice is from 9 to 11 a.m. on those days, and from 4 to 6 p.m. on Thursdays.
How Do I Know If I Qualify For The Team?
Only swimmers who have reached the "Breakers" level, or swimmers from the high school team, are eligible to swim with the Breakers team. The coaches will determine the placement of each swimmer based on the swimmer's mastery of the different strokes, swimmer's goals, etc. Swimmers new to the team will be evaluated by the coaches in the first week of practice.
